Date night has changed

Date night used to be only on Friday and Saturday but as time has changed and the singles are getting older date night is now any day of the week. With singles no longer being in the early twenties and dating people are now finding themselves on the dating scene in their late sixties. It is for this reason that people will choose any day of the week to go out and have a good time while looking for true love.

Most people only think that true love happens when you are young but the reality is that it can occur at any age. That is why the dating scene has changed to any night of the week and for most people this works out perfectly because it is easier to get a sitter other days of the week when more people do not have anything to do at night. Some people would say that the whole dating scene has changed drastically, but the reality is that the dating scene has learned to adapt to what people need in life. The fact that most people who are single are also a single parent means that they will need a sitter at some point, and if they do not need a sitter then they are busy working on a Friday or Saturday night so other days of the week fit in perfectly.
